Vjenceslav Novak

The plot of the novel The Last Stipančići is set in the first decade of the 19th century. It focuses on the decline of a patrician family and goes far back in time, to the last two generations of this family.

Through faithful descriptions, one can follow all the events on the Croatian political scene, as well as individual upheavals and the war's effects on the entire nation, but shown through the life and work of the sole protagonist, Ante Stipančić. After reading the novel, a bitter taste remains, accompanied by memories of the relationship of society towards individuals and vice versa, the relationship between spouses, the relationship of a father towards children that is anything but parental, and above all, the relationship of a son towards his mother and sister. The immense wealth that was inherited is all the pride of this family, which places all its hopes and dreams in its only son who becomes a "prodigal son", and with its frivolous lifestyle brings itself and its family to the brink of begging, not caring after the death of its father for its sick sister or its mother, who live in the worst misery, and all because of him.
